Update 4:47 p.m.:  The fire was discovered by a firefighter traveling on Poor House Road.  He observed smoke coming from the back of the home.  The investigation revealed that failure of an electrical switch was the cause of the fire.  The homeowner was displaced and is being assisted by friends.  There were no injuries as a result of this incident.

This update corrects the earlier report of the possibility of a canine death. The Office of the State Fire Marshal reports there are no injuries or deaths. 


La Plata, MD- A single family house fire has been reported on Poorhouse Road in the area of Mt. Pisgah Farm Road.  Units are on the scene and it is being reported that there is one, possibly two canine fatalities. The Fire Marshal has been dispatched to the scene.
